Attack Of The Clones

Parody of Don McLean's "American Pie"
Copyright 2002 by Michael Nabert

A long long time ago
The Galactic Senate
Feared many systems might secede
They argued in their parliament
Whether it was expedient
To build an army that they just might need
And Ani tried to find out who
Attacked the lady from Naboo
He talked back to his master
And said "Promote me faster"
It's true he showed a lot of skill
But Obi Wan said "Wait until
Your wisdom grows to match your will
Impulsive padewan"

It's all true, it was in Episode II
The Best Star Wars film in nineteen years I've got to tell you
It's got Christopher Lee playing Count Dooku
And Jar Jar's scenes are mercifully few

Zam Wessel led them on a chase
'Round Coruscant at breakneck pace
Jango killed her 'fore she confessed
Then Obi Wan investigates
And while he's gone young Ani dates
Amidala, who's often overdressed
On Naboo they share tender scenes
But in his dreams his mother screams
To Tattooine they go
And the Tuskens are laid low
He tries to woo the former queen
Like an obsessive brooding teen
With glimpses of his dark side seen
Our fated Darth to be

He started singin'
It's all true, it was in Episode II
The Best Star Wars film in nineteen years I've got to tell you
It's got Christopher Lee playing Count Dooku
And the best projection's digital, too

When Obi Wan's lead was run to ground
The Kaminoan world he found
They said "You've been expected here
We wondered when you'd come to get
Your million clones of Jango Fett
That we've been working on this past ten years"
Trying to bring the Fett man in
Almost cost Obi Wan his skin
He learned Count Dooku's plot
And then got himself caught
So the Geonosians gaily planned
An execution they thought grand
With giant beasts and bloody sand
And buzzing insect crowds

They were singin'
It's all true, it was in Episode II
The Best Star Wars film in nineteen years I've got to tell you
It's got Christopher Lee playing Count Dooku
And Samuel Jackson as Mace Windu

Ani and Padme soon appeared
And soon got captured like we'd feared
I'm sure it left them both annoyed
Mace Windu cut off Jango's head
And grimly counted Jedi dead
As Jedi masters clashed with battle droids
And wizened Yoda made the scene
With clone troopers and war machines
Dooku cut Ani's wrist through
And bested Obi Wan too
Then the two foot Jedi we love best
Put Count Dooku's talents to the test
And Yoda left us all impressed
But Dooku got away

And we were singin'
It's all true, it was in Episode II
The Best Star Wars film in nineteen years I've got to tell you
It's got Christopher Lee playing Count Dooku
There's amazing things a muppet can do
And we were singin'
It's all true, it was in Episode II
The Best Star Wars film in nineteen years I've got to tell you
It's got Christopher Lee playing Count Dooku
And I know the Force is with me and you
